I. Evaluating Learning Direction: Trace the path of a message from the sense organs to the brain by sequencing the events below.
Use numbers 1-5. Write your answer on the space provided before each letter.
______A. The sensory nerves of the nose bring the message to the brain.
______B. The brain instructs the motor nerves to move.
______C. The boy smells the food being cooked.
______D. The brain interprets the message.
______E. Mother is cooking adobo.
